The Wellcome Trust is a global charitable foundation. We improve health for everyone by funding science, leading policy and advocacy campaigns, and building partnerships.

We plan to spend £16bn over the next ten years, funding new discoveries in life, health and wellbeing, and taking on three global health challenges: mental health, infectious disease and climate and health.

These challenges need the bold science we support, but they won't be solved by science alone.

Where in Wellcome will I be working?

Within the Strategy Department, the Organisational Planning team enables Wellcome to deliver its mission by aligning priorities, resources and delivery, specifically leading identification of organisational objectives, overseeing strategic resource allocation, embedding systematic performance and continuous learning, and strengthening programme and portfolio management.

What will I be doing?

Working within Organisational Planning in the Strategy Department, you'll lead and embed fit‑for‑purpose programme management standards, champion shared learning and best practice, and ensure core tools are well used. You'll coach and support colleagues to build capability and foster a community of practice that strengthens delivery across Wellcome's strategic programmes.

As a Programmatic Excellence Lead, you will:
  • Set programme management standards - Develop and maintain clear, consistent guidance and tools that support effective delivery and promote One Wellcome ways of working.
  • Build capability and community - Provide training, coaching and create a community of practice to share learning, solve challenges and support professional growth.
  • Maintain portfolio oversight - Keep a forward view of major cross-organisational programmes to identify sequencing, resource needs and interdependencies, informing planning and prioritisation.
  • Embed continuous learning - Advise on integrated reporting and ensure lessons learned are captured and applied to future planning and delivery.
  • Collaborate across Wellcome - Work closely with Strategy, Operations and other teams to align approaches and contribute to an inclusive, high-performing culture.
  • Champion governance and adaptability - Operate within Wellcome's policies, values and budget, and remain flexible to evolving priorities to help deliver Wellcome's mission.
Is this job for me?

You’ll thrive in this role if you bring deep experience in programme and project management, with the ability to tailor best practice to different contexts and embed practical frameworks that drive impact. Strong collaboration, communication and relationship-building skills are essential, alongside a proactive, adaptable approach and a passion for Wellcome's mission. Professional qualifications in programme management and experience delivering complex, cross-organisational initiatives will help you succeed.
